 By: Lucio III H.B. No. 268


 A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
 AN ACT
 relating to considering ownership interests of disabled veterans in
 determining whether a business is a historically underutilized
 business for purposes of state contracting.
 B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
 SECTION 1. Section 2161.001(3), Government Code, is amended
 to read as follows:
 (3) "Economically disadvantaged person" means a
 person who is economically disadvantaged because of the person's
 identification as a member of a certain group, including Black
 Americans, Hispanic Americans, women, Asian Pacific Americans,
 [and] Native Americans, and veterans as defined by 38 U.S.C.
 Section 101(2) who have a service-connected disability as defined
 by 38 U.S.C. Section 101(16), and who has suffered the effects of
 discriminatory practices or other similar insidious circumstances
 over which the person has no control.
 SECTION 2. Section 2161.125, Government Code, is amended to
 read as follows:
 Sec. 2161.125. CATEGORIZATION BY SEX, RACE, AND ETHNICITY.
 The comptroller, in cooperation with each state agency reporting
 under this subchapter, shall categorize each historically
 underutilized business included in a report under this subchapter
 by sex, race, and ethnicity and by whether the historically
 underutilized business derives its status as a historically
 underutilized business because it is owned or owned, operated, and
 controlled, as applicable, wholly or partly by one or more veterans
 as defined by 38 U.S.C. Section 101(2) who have a service-connected
 disability as defined by 38 U.S.C. Section 101(16).
 SECTION 3. This Act takes effect September 1, 2009.
